Start Date
Immediate
Expiry Date
05 Aug, 25
Salary
147000.0
Posted On
06 May, 25
Experience
6 year(s) or above
Remote Job
Yes
Telecommute
Yes
Sponsor Visa
No
Skills
Communication Skills, Collaboration, Consumer Insight, Platforms, Learning Environment, Strategic Thinking, Mintel, Business Insights, Technical Proficiency, Activations, Kantar, Social Sciences, Qualitative Data, Agility, Storytelling
Industry
Marketing/Advertising/Sales
The Human Insights Sr. Manager, Brand Insights will play a key role on our North America Operating Unit (NAOU) Portfolio Strategy & Human Insights team. You’ll be responsible for market research consumer & marketplace analytics, and strategic consulting to develop and implement a brand/category learning plan and integrate insights across our Marketing teams and global network.
In this role, you’ll lead custom research and analysis across brand strategy, communication, and innovation and will partner with Marketing stakeholders and cross functional teams. Your insights will shape strategic initiatives, leveraging the power of data and storytelling. Success in this role requires strong communication skills, ability to influence, and comfort working in a fast-paced, dynamic, and networked environment. You’ll bring a strong background in both custom research and syndicated marketing intelligence with a passion for continuous learning.
QUALIFICATIONS & REQUIREMENTS
Minimum:
Preferred:
CORE SKILLS